I'm really surprised that Man City are performing this poorly. I know they’ve had some injury issues, but they’re still underperforming.
Chelsea have been playing decent football, beating West Ham and Fulham. Their next three fixtures are similar to the previous three, so they could realistically expect around 14 points from six rounds.
Arsenal played an awful game against Liverpool, and if it weren’t for Szoboszlai’s wonder goal, the match would have definitely ended 0–0. I'm not quite satisfied with how they're playing overall — without Ødegaard and Saka, there's a real lack of creativity.
Liverpool are winning, but they’re clearly struggling to keep clean sheets. Sooner or later, their luck will run out.
And what can you say about Man Utd? They might finish in a better table position than last year, but not by much—10th place at best.
